    The Department of Defense, specifically the Department of the Army through the W072 Endist Detroit office, is seeking information from businesses regarding their capabilities in sewer inspection and cleaning services under the GKW Sewer Inspection and Cleaning initiative. This Sources Sought notice aims to identify qualified vendors capable of performing sewer management services, with a focus on experience and socio-economic diversity, as businesses are requested to provide details about their past projects, socio-economic status, and interest in future bidding opportunities. The services are critical for maintaining effective waste management systems, particularly in the Berkley, Michigan area, where the work will be performed.     The GKW Sewer Inspection and Cleaning Sources Sought Survey aims to gather information from businesses about their capabilities in sewer inspection and cleaning services, classified under NAICS Code 562998. Respondents are asked to provide company information, socio-economic status (e.g., large or small business, disadvantaged status), and examples of three relevant past projects completed within the last five years, detailing contract numbers, completion year, roles as prime or subcontractor, percentage of work self-performed, and project value. Additionally, companies must describe their capability to perform the required work at the designated location and indicate their interest in bidding if the requirement is advertised. This document serves as a preliminary step for the government to identify qualified vendors meeting the criteria for upcoming contracting opportunities in sewer management services, emphasizing the importance of experience and socio-economic diversity among potential contractors.

    The Department of Defense, specifically the Department of the Army, is seeking contractors for the project titled "VGLZ 182038 REPAIR SANITARY SEWER SYSTEM BASE WIDE." This project entails the mobilization and demobilization of labor, equipment, and materials to replace approximately 11,164 linear feet of sanitary sewer lines, repair and replace manholes, and manage the abandonment of certain sewer segments in a former residential area. The work will utilize various methods, including open cut, pipe bursting, and horizontal directional drilling, highlighting the importance of effective sewer infrastructure maintenance.     The Department of Defense, specifically the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) Detroit District, is preparing to solicit bids for the Detroit River Maintenance Dredging and Confined Disposal Facility (CDF) Maintenance project in Detroit, Michigan. The project involves mobilizing a dredge to the Detroit River, mechanically dredging the Lower Livingstone and East Outer Channels, and placing the dredged material at the Pointe Mouillee CDF, along with maintenance tasks such as mowing, road improvements, and vegetation clearing. This procurement is significant for maintaining navigational channels and environmental management, with the contract expected to be a firm-fixed price and set aside entirely for small businesses under NAICS code 237990.
